6 Measuring bales of straw hay bales
Always inject the electrodes form the plain side of round bales never from the round side, the probe can be
inserted much easier. For strongly pressed bales we suggest the probe GSF 40 or GSF 40 TF instead.
7 Wood Chips as fuel
Instrument settings for measuring wood chips:
GMH 3830/3850/3851 Version>= 1.5: h.461 (specialised GSF 38 / GSF 50 curve)
others: We recommend “Wood group C” (GMH 38x0 instruments: “h. C”). This group delivers a sufficient
accuracy for the fuel application up to 30% MC – above there is larger deviation.
Wood chips are classified in different quality groups.
The size and the moisture content (MC or u) or the wet-basis moisture content (w) are the measure for the
usability. Usually moisture content (w) of maximum 30% is recommended.

7.1 Field measuring
At measuring in containers, silos, chip bunkers or similar storages and a measuring depth > 0.5 m commonly
the compression is high enough for direct measuring.
Although keep pressure on the handle during the measuring!
For measuring in less than 0.5 m or in loose bulk material, best is to step on the measuring spot and insert
the probe below the foot.
At values above 20%u the display may have falling values: The display after 10 seconds is valid!
7.2 Reference procedure: „Bucket test“
The probes from suitable places in Your material into a bucket ( (>=10 litre).
Compress: Step into the bucket and compress with roughly 10 kg. Measure under Your foot:
During measuring keep pressure on the handle!
Repeat Your measuring and take average of 3 measurings!
At values above 20%u the display may have falling values: The display after 10 seconds is valid!
